What is the word for the first number of an ordered pair?

Respuesta :

Аноним Аноним
  • 21-10-2019

Answer:

The center of the coordinate system (where the lines intersect) is called the origin. ... An ordered pair contains the coordinates of one point in the coordinate system. A point is named by its ordered pair of the form of (x, y). The first number corresponds to the x-coordinate and the second to the y-coordinate.
